Transaction 6399476a0cba26ac18efc07e7ed8039eb6c39852aeafa23303837167d7131037
1 Input
1 Output
-
6399476a0cba26ac18efc07e7ed8039eb6c39852aeafa23303837167d7131037:0
- value
- 31577665
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d8bf0662125c01fa11ff89a2f359ea621c1a1bf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CSq77fywXnmuR3CoUoWwmidYnPJADPX8u